Quran Teaches Love For Humanity

Islam teaches love and peace, it is the religion of God; therefore, it helps and promotes love for humanity. It states that service of humanity leads to the path of faith. Muslims must get engaged in different social welfare activities and fulfill the needs of other Muslims.

Quran, Holy Quran, Qur’an, learn Quran, learn Quran online,

In the verse 111, chapter 3, it is said: “You are the best people raised for the good of mankind: you enjoy good and forbid evil and believe in Allah.”

It is clear from the above mentioned verse that all the Muslims have been told to serve the mankind in the best possible manner and they must promote goodness. If they do not achieve this, then they cannot get into the list of best people. If you study Live Quran, you will then know about the love of Humanity. But the teachings of Islam say that Muslims must serve mankind with kindness and love.

According to the teachings of Quran, every person must display kindness to every other person, regardless of how they behave with you. By following these teachings, you can create love, peace, and harmony in the society. Prophet Muhammad (P.B.U.H) emphasized on sympathy, kindness, and love towards all the mankind and said: “One who is not grateful to mankind is not grateful to Allah.”

In another place it is said: “None among you is a true believer unless he loves for others what he loves for himself.”All the creatures in this world are created by Allah, therefore they should be treated with kindness.

Idol Worship: Why Do The Muslims Worship, And Bow Down To The Kaaba In Their Prayer?

Kaaba is the house of Allah or the holiest place of worship and it is the Qibla or the direction that Muslims face during their prayers. There is the need of intellectual abilities to think that Muslims just face the Kaaba to offer their prayers but not bow to it. The purpose to face the Kaaba is the proof of the unity of all Muslims on one point that Allah is one and there is no one whom we worship except Allah. Quran Reading is the best habit if we try to develop it on our daily basis so surly we will come to know the realities of Islam and its rules.

“We see the turning of thy face (for guidance) to the heavens: now shall we turn thee to a Qibla that shall please thee. Turn then thy face in the direction of the holy Mosque: wherever ye are, turn your faces in that direction.”(2:144). you will be surprised to know that the Kaaba is in the center of the world and the credit goes to the Muslims who first draw the map of the world. As Muslims we need to clarify all the concepts that other religions have some doubts about. The purpose of performing Tawaaf round the Kaaba is to show the belief that there is only one GOD whom we worship at one platform.

The concept of kissing the black stone of Kaaba is the Sunnah of Prophet Muhammad (pbuh) that all Muslims follow during Tawaaf. Hazrat Umer (R.A) said that “I know that you are a stone and can neither benefit nor harm. Had I not seen the Prophet (pbuh) touching (and kissing) you, I would never have touched (and kissed) you”. In the prophet’s time people use to stand on the Kaaba to say Adaan, now there is a valid question that is at the same time is the best answer of their question is that which idol worshipper stand on the idol he worships. Ramadan Diet Chart for Diabetics Patient

Ramadan is a blessed month from ALLAH towards Muslims. This month teaches us the way of life. Fasting in Ramadan is a duty of every Muslim. Diabetic patience should also fast in Ramadan but have to follow a diet chart for their health. ALLAH never forces on doing something but he makes easiness in each and every aspect of life. Diabetic patience should have to develop a chart and their requirements of a body according to the doctor for the Ramadan food. Because fasting specially in summer can make problems for the patients of diabetics.

  • During fasting the insulin should be reduced because the amount of insulin can cause to hypoglycemia.
  • Monitor sugar level routinely.
  • Take variety of food in average rate. But the quantity of food should be reduced from normal days.
  • Take fruits after meal daily. More and more fruits are good for diabetic’s patient.
  • Take water time by time because less water can cause dehydration.
  • Avoid being eating spicy food and drinking coffee and tea.
  • Oily and fried things can be harmful for diabetic’s patient.

Ramadan makes our life perfect and teaches us the right way, similarly fasting in Ramadan make us more healthy and fresh. It improves blood cholesterol and controls the gastric problems and constipation.
